What is the average monthly cost for RV storage in Fairfax, MO, and what factors affect the price?
In Fairfax, uncovered outdoor storage typically ranges from $40 to $80 per month, while covered or indoor storage can cost $100 to $200+. Prices are influenced by the size of your RV, the level of protection (outdoor, covered, or enclosed), and specific facility amenities. Compared to larger Missouri cities, Fairfax often offers more affordable rates due to its rural setting.
How do Fairfax winters affect my choice of RV storage?
Fairfax experiences cold winters with potential for snow and ice. For long-term winter storage, an indoor, heated unit is ideal to protect plumbing and appliances from freeze damage. If using outdoor storage, a facility that allows you to winterize your RV on-site is crucial. Many local owners opt for covered storage to shield their RV from heavy snow loads and ice accumulation.

What security features should I look for in a Fairfax RV storage facility?
Prioritize facilities with gated access, personalized entry codes, and good perimeter lighting. Given Fairfax's smaller community, a facility with 24/7 video surveillance provides significant peace of mind. Many local lots also have on-site managers or regular patrols, which adds an extra layer of security in this rural area.

First, understand your storage needs based on our local climate. Fairfax winters can be harsh, with ice, snow, and freezing temperatures. For this reason, covered or fully enclosed storage is a premium choice. It shields your RV's roof, seals, and exterior from the elements, preventing sun damage in summer and ice dam buildup in winter. While open, fenced lots are more affordable and suitable for short-term stays, a long winter is best weathered under a roof. When touring facilities, ask about their specific winter protocols, like whether they handle snow removal from around your unit.
Location and accessibility are key. You'll want a facility that's conveniently located for those last-minute trips to load up or check on things. Many storage facilities in our region are situated on the outskirts of towns, offering easier maneuvering for larger rigs. Check the access hours—some offer 24/7 gate access, while others may have more restricted schedules. For those who like to do off-season maintenance or early-spring de-winterizing, finding a place that allows you to work on your RV onsite can be a huge bonus.
Security is non-negotiable. Look for features like gated entry with personalized codes, good lighting, and perimeter fencing. A well-managed facility often has cameras and regular staff patrols. Don't hesitate to ask the manager about their security measures; their confidence in answering is a good sign.

Finally, think beyond just storage. Does the facility offer amenities like dump stations, freshwater fill-ups, or electrical hookups for battery maintenance? These services can save you time and hassle when preparing for your next adventure along I-29 or heading out to the Missouri River.
